Every Winter Bowls season produces its front-runners.
These are the bowlers who perform week after week, regardless of whether the greens are fast or slow, or whether the weather is warm, cold, sunny or wet.
With only a maximum of three playing days remaining in the two competitions, the battle for top spot is reaching its climax.
On Saturdays, Steve van der Veen leads the field, with Paul Badenoch, Stew Allen, Alan Speck and Libby Lock all within striking distance.
On Wednesdays, Cathy Stevens heads the leaderboard, chased by Steve van der Veen, Giovanni Spagnuolo, John Blue, Mick Underwood and Ralph Hounslow.
Can Steve and Cathy hold on?
Or will one of the chasing pack produce a late-season surge?
